더러브렛 말에서 관절경을 이용한 먼쪽 노뼈 뼈연골종의 치료
- Abstract
- Osteochondroma (OC) is a cartilage-capped exostosis. In horses, OC commonly develops on the caudal distal metaphysis of the radius (CDMR). OC is a disease that reqires treatment because it cause lameness and reduces exercise capasity. The purpose of study was to describe the outcomes of arthroscopy for the treatment of OC on CDMR. Diagnosis was based on clinical signs (lameness and distention of carpal sheath), radiography (location and size of OC), and ultrasonography (location of OC, torn deep digital flexor tendon, fibrin, and effusion of carpal sheath). Arthroscopy was performed on 68 cases in Thoroughbred horses with OC on CDMR. Sixty of the 68 cases showed deep digital flexor tendinitis as a result of sharp protuberances of the OC. All horses survived, and 63 of the 68 cases returned to athletic function (racing) after arthroscopy. So, arthroscopy is recommended for treating OC of CDMR in horses.
